King Charles III arrives in Canada amid tension with Trump
May 26, 2025
British monarch is expected to voice support for Canada's sovereignty against the US president's 51st state comments.
May 26, 2025
British monarch is expected to voice support for Canada's sovereignty against the US president's 51st state comments.